Default looking to get headers

ok im looking to buy headers but i dont want to pay an outrageous price. so u guys know where i can get the best deal on headers? also how hard is installation having never done this before, or if i have a shop do it how much would it cost in general. lastly what do i need along with headers, such as a y-pipe, etc. thanks

pacesetters are just about the cheapest, and there are a lot of haters out there but im happy with mine also got pacesetter off road y pipe before the new design and have had no problems other than a little banging on the floorboard on a cold startup, did the installation with a friend, its pretty easy, knotched the k member a little and removed the steering knuckle, if you get no smog headers you will have to remove your EGR and AIR as i did and you will have to get 02 sims for the rear 02's and 02 extensions for the front 02's

Pacesetter's are cheap and fit great. If you live in a mild climate then the coating should last. The only thing I had to do was grind off the extra casting on the block. Very easy to do. The new design has a lot of clearance and didn't require notching of the K member. Got mine from speed-eng, they're a sponsor. But if you can pick up a set of high end headers for cheap, then I would go that route. But if you want new and don't wanna spend a lot of money, then Pacesetters work great.
